Wrinkles are folds, ridges, or furrows in the skin. They develop inevitably as we age and our skin loses its elasticity. They can appear on various parts of the body, but they are most commonly associated with the face, neck, and hands. The wrinkles form as a result of the breakdown of collagen and elastin fibers. This happens when skin starts to lose flexibility. Facial expressions like frowning or squinting cause fine lines and wrinkles to appear . As a person ages, these lines become more pronounced. There are a combination of factors that may lead to the formation of wrinkles. This includes sun exposure, facial expressions, genetics, smoking, dehydration and environmental factors. Several effective options for face and neck wrinkle treatments may help you achieve your goals:

Botox and Fillers:

botox and dermal fillers are both popular non-surgical cosmetic treatments. They help reduce the appearance of wrinkles and fine lines. they work in different ways. Botox can temporarily relax the muscles that cause dynamic wrinkles. This may include crow's feet, forehead lines, and frown lines. Since it helps reduce the appearance of wrinkles caused by muscle contractions, it is most effective in smoothing out expression lines. Most dermal fillers are often hyaluronic acid-based. They can add volume and fill in static wrinkles. It helps plump up sunken areas a loss of collagen and facial fat due to aging.

Laser and Light Treatments: 

Laser and light treatments for wrinkles are non-surgical treatments. They can target and improve the appearance of wrinkles and fine lines on the skin. These treatments stimulate collagen production, resurface the skin, or promote new skin growth. For example, our Lumenis IPL uses a broad spectrum of light. It can target pigmentation irregularities, redness, and fine lines. It can improve skin tone and texture, making it look smoother and more youthful.

Microdermabrasion: 

Microdermabrasion is a popular non-invasive cosmetic treatment. It causes the exfoliation and resurfacing of the outermost layer of the skin.  It involves exfoliation and suction simultaneously. This treatment can improve skin texture and tone.

Surgical Options: 

One can consider surgical options for wrinkles when non-surgical treatments is not effective. These include face lifts, neck lifts, blepharoplasty, and brow lifts. The post-recovery process is a significant consideration in these more invasive treatments.

Treating Wrinkles in Vancouver: Cost and Financing

The cost of each treatment depends on an individual’s treatment areas from face, neck to body. On average the cost of Botox is around $10-12 per unit making the procedure cost around $200 to $1000. Dermal fillers cost around $450-$850 per syringe. Medical grade microneedling costs around $300-$400 per session. The cost of IPL treatment varies depending on depends on the total areas covered. Exosome treatment costs around $825 per session. Ultherapy Treatments may cost $2000-3800 depending on the areas treated.

FREQUENTLY ASKED QUESTIONS

How long do the wrinkle treatment results typically last?

The results depend on each procedure and vary from treatment to treatment. For instance, Botox results usually last for 3-4 months whereas dermal fillers last for 6-18 months. The results of Ultherapy last up to 2 years. 

What are the potential side effects or risks of wrinkle treatments?

The potential side effects or risks for both Botox and dermal fillers include mild pain, redness, or bruising. Dermal fillers may cause some swelling post treatment. These side effects typically resolve on their own within hours to days. Our highly trained doctors ensure treatment safety by practicing with care. 

How to prepare for a treatment session?

Preparing for a skincare treatment session is essential to ensure that you achieve the best results and minimize the risk of complications. This includes discontinuing products (AHAs and BHAs) for a short time, avoiding sun exposure, cleansing skin and staying hydrated.

What is the recovery time and post-treatment precautions?

The recovery time varies from treatment to treatment. The recovery time for Botox and dermal fillers is minimal. There is no recovery time for Ultherapy. The recovery time for microneedling, exosome treatment, and chemical peels is usually 2-3 days. Post-treatment precaution focus is on avoiding sun exposure or active skin care products. 

Are there topical wrinkle creams and skin care that help remove wrinkles?

Topical retinoids like tretinoin (Renova, Retin-A) and tazarotene (Tazorac), Adapalene and retinols in medical grade skin care can help increase collagen and prevent wrinkles. Depending on your skin type, you may tolerate different strengths and type of retinoid.
